Kano Court Sentences 19-Year-Old Woman to Death for Husband’s Killing

A Kano State High Court has sentenced a 19-year-old woman, Saudat Jibrin, to death by hanging after convicting her of culpable homicide in connection with her husband’s death.

The victim, Salisu Idris, was 30 years old and was killed nine days after the couple’s wedding.

Justice Maryam Sabo delivered the judgment on Thursday, July 30, 2026, ruling that the prosecution had established its case beyond reasonable doubt.

The judge consequently sentenced Jibrin to death by hanging and informed her that she had 90 days to challenge the decision through an appeal.

Jibrin, a resident of Kumbotso Local Government Area of Kano State, had denied committing the offence during the trial.

Prosecution counsel Lamido Abba-Sorondinki told the court that the incident occurred on May 5, 2025, at Farawa Quarters in Kano.

According to the prosecution, Jibrin placed a substance in her husband’s “Zoho” drink at about 9 p.m. before cutting his throat with a knife.

The prosecution called two witnesses to support the culpable homicide charge brought against the defendant.

Abba-Sorondinki argued that the offence violated Section 221(a) of the Penal Code.

Defence counsel Abdulfatah Muhammad presented Jibrin as a witness during the defence stage of the trial.

Following her conviction, Muhammad appealed to the court for leniency, stating that his client had undergone personal reform while being held in custody.

The lawyer told the court that Jibrin had memorised the Holy Qur’an during her detention and had become a changed person.

He also asked the court to consider her family responsibilities, describing her as her parents’ eldest child and saying that her younger siblings depended on her for support.

The court, however, found that the prosecution had proven the culpable homicide charge and imposed the death sentence prescribed under the applicable law.

Jibrin may appeal the judgment within the 90-day period granted by the court.
